5 most difficult things about hiring developers
DigitalOcean has recently published a report regarding the top five struggles companies mostly experience when hiring developers.
The report has unlocked the following these five difficulties:
- Lack of formal software engineering education (39%)
- Limited pool of candidates with relevant job/technical skills (18%)
- Lack of soft skills/workplace competencies (15%)
- Losing top candidates to competing offers (15%)
- Salary demands too high (13%)
Other issues that were listed above are according to some of the requirements that recruitment managers have included in the job description.
Priorities between recruitment managers and developers may not always align, and these may cause problems in the future.
However, note that these things can be avoided. Now, you may ask how? The solution is, hire an offshore team that will serve as an extension of your local software development.
Let us talk about how these difficulties can be solved by hiring your own offshore developers.
Five most difficult things about hiring developers
Here we will be further discussing the five most difficult about hiring developers, and how offshoring can help:
Lack of formal software engineering education
An offshore software development provider has well skilled and experienced developers. They are usually software developers that are medior to senior level. These experts usually also have experience working with different clients from different industries.
These offshoring companies continuously hone their employees skills by giving them regular training. More so, keep them up-to-date with the latest developments and technologies.
Limited pool of candidates with relevant job/technical skills
Just like any BPO firm, Offshore software development companies always have a wide pool of developers.
As for businesses that are hiring developers, always check whether your required developers are available? Determine if their level of skills suit your job requirements? And check if the price is within your budget.
Lack of soft skills/workplace competencies
To help you recruit the right candidates with the right mix of soft and technical skills you need, focus on both during your hiring process. Do not also forget to check for their organizational skills.
Although you may always be require to work in your office space, you should also be open to a flexible working environment. Another important thing to consider is performing team buildings.
This way, your developers can cultivate working relationships, thus, developers will be inspired to be dedicated to their jobs!
Losing top candidates to competing offers
Employees may always seek better opportunities elsewhere, especially if they are given competing offers from other companies. The good news is that this can be avoided.
For your offshore team, ensure that you have a better understanding of your individual candidates. Particularly, know their expected salaries so you won’t lose them over competing offers from other companies.
Salary demands too high
Salaries in the tech industry are always increasing. A good offshore software development company always makes sure to hire top talents without having to pay an overload.
They also give their developers secondary employee benefits that they deserve. Further, they also give importance to their developers personal needs.
Keep in mind that if an offshore software development company takes good care of their software developers, they will have a fully dedicated team!
And that’s what you should look for in a software developer provider.